What is a wind turbine generator foundation?

Wind turbine generator (WTG) foundations are estimated to represent approximately 25% of the balance of plant (BOP) cost of a wind farm. The foundation supports a multimillion-dollar asset, without which revenue would be impossible, yet this asset is mainly invisible and its operational health unknown.

What is assembled wind turbine foundation?

The assembled wind turbine foundation adopts the construction method of standardized design and factory mass production, and it can solve the quality and discontinuous pouring problems caused by on-site mixing in remote mountainous areas due to the non-transportation of commercial mixing.

How do turbine foundations work?

The design of the turbine foundations take into account the normal operating and extreme load conditions imposed by the turbine. The standard method of providing support to the turbine is by way of a concrete gravity base, typically of a cir-cular shape to account of the variable directional nature of the design loadings.

What is the design process of a wind turbine?

Design process The design process involves an initial site selection followed by an assessment of external conditions, selection of wind turbine size, subsurface investigation, assessment of geo-hazards, foundation and support structure selection, developing design load cases, and performing geotechnical and structural analyses.
